Roble Shipping launches first brand-new RORO passenger vessel, M/V Mother Immaculate Stars

Roble Shipping Inc., the leading ferry operator connecting Cebu and Leyte, officially marked a historic milestone with the successful launch of its first-ever, brand-new Roll-on/Roll-off (RORO) passenger vessel, M/V Mother Immaculate Stars.

The state-of-the-art vessel was custom-built and launched at the Taizhou Hongtai Shipyard Industry Co. Ltd. in Taizhou, China, signaling a new era of modernized, safer, and more comfortable maritime travel for the Philippine domestic shipping industry.

The M/V Mother Immaculate Stars represents a significant upgrade in Roble Shipping’s fleet capabilities, combining impressive capacity with strict international safety standards.

  • Dimensions: 95 meters in length and 20 meters in width.

  • Tonnage & Capacity: Listed gross tonnage of 6,483 tons with a Deadweight Tonnage (DWT) of 1,700.

  • Classification: Registered under the Registro Italiano Navale (RINA) of Italy, an International Association of Classification Societies (IACS) member, ensuring top-tier structural and operational integrity.

  • Identification: IMO Number 1124528. “This is a momentous day not just for Roble Shipping, but for the thousands of passengers who rely on us for safe and efficient travel between Cebu and Leyte. The M/V Mother Immaculate Stars is a testament to our commitment to upgrading Philippine domestic seafaring standards, said Roble Shipping Inc. Management

The brand-new vessel is currently undergoing final outfitting and sea trials in China. She is expected to sail to the Philippines and arrive by the end of the second quarter of 2026.

While Roble Shipping has yet to officially announce the specific route assignment for the M/V Mother Immaculate Stars, industry insiders and ship-spotting enthusiasts are already buzzing with anticipation about where this magnificent vessel will make her maiden commercial voyage.
